Dubahi - Kurhani, Muzaffarpur

Dubahi is a village situated in the Kurhani subdivision of Muzaffarpur district, Bihar. It is located approximately 8 km from the tehsil headquarters in Kurhani and around 21 km from the district headquarters in Muzaffarpur. Chhajan Harishankar West serves as the Gram Panchayat for Dubahi village.

As per Census 2011, the village code of Dubahi is 229461. The village covers a total geographical area of 298 hectares and falls under the 844127 pincode. Muzaffarpur is the nearest town, located about 21 km away.

Dubahi village is governed under the Panchayati Raj system, with a Sarpanch serving as the elected head.

Population of Dubahi

According to the 2011 Census, Dubahi village had a total population of 4,448 people, including 2,374 males and 2,074 females, living in 834 households. The sex ratio was 874 females per 1,000 males. The overall literacy rate was 64.57%, with male literacy at 75.17% and female literacy at 52.50%. The Scheduled Caste (SC) population was 674.

Transport and Connectivity of Dubahi

Dubahi is connected by an all-weather road, while public transport facilities are available within 2-5 km of the village. The nearest railway station is Turki, while the nearest airport is Muzaffarpur Airport, situated at an approximate aerial distance of 6.1 km.
